Iowa caucus: Nikki Haley says Iowa made Republican Primary a ‘two-person race’ after finishing third

  • Most Republicans at Iowa's caucus believe Donald Trump would be fit for the White House even if convicted of a crime, highlighting his stronghold on the party.
  • Trump's victory in the Iowa caucus solidifies his position as the leading candidate for the 2024 Republican presidential nomination.
  • Trump's enduring popularity among Republican voters and his strong position in national primary polls make him difficult to challenge for the nomination.
